Hello there, Im replying to the message: Has anyone had CVS, and
completely recover from it... Well Im a CVS recoverer.. I wasnt
actually tittled or diagnosed with CVS.. I had the migraines, severe
throwing up, horrible stomach aches, that would last for days at a
time.. and led to black outs, loss of vision, hospitalization ect. My
son was recently diagnossed after 8yrs of horrible episodes of the same
symptoms I had as a child. Now they have a name for it.. CVS. Well I
had all my symptoms up till the day I had my son; I was 20yrs old..
which hes 9yrs old now. I still get migrains occasionally. . however
nothing like what I went through as a child through a young adult. Its
almost like my hormones changed and my symptoms went away. THANK GOD!
Sadly my son goes through the exact same thing I did.... IF you have
more questions.. pleas feel free to contact me.
